Introduction

Inflation, the steady increase in prices of goods and services over time, is a phenomenon that has far-reaching consequences for various sectors of the economy. One such sector that’s significantly feeling the heat of inflation is home building in the United States. As inflation continues to climb, the cost of constructing new homes has surged, presenting challenges for both builders and potential homeowners. In this article, we’ll delve into how inflation is affecting home building across the USA and explore the implications of these rising costs.

The Rising Costs of Materials

One of the primary drivers behind the inflation-induced challenges in the home building industry is the escalating cost of construction materials. From lumber to steel to concrete, the prices of essential building components have witnessed substantial increases in recent years. Lumber prices, for instance, experienced a dramatic surge, driven by supply chain disruptions and increased demand during the pandemic. This surge not only impacted the cost of wood-framed structures but also sent ripple effects throughout the construction industry.

Builders, grappling with higher material costs, find themselves in a dilemma. They must either absorb these increased expenses, which eats into their profit margins, or pass them onto the potential homeowners, making housing less affordable. Inflation’s impact on material costs also trickles down to other aspects of home construction, such as plumbing fixtures, electrical wiring, and roofing materials, further compounding the issue.

Labor Shortages and Wage Pressures

In addition to materials, another crucial factor affecting the home building industry is the labor shortage combined with wage pressures. The construction industry has been grappling with a shortage of skilled labor for years, and the pandemic only exacerbated this challenge. The demand for new Homes continues to rise, but the supply of skilled workers is struggling to keep up. As a result, construction companies are faced with the need to offer higher wages to attract and retain skilled labor, further driving up construction loan and construction costs.

Higher wages can have a cascading effect on overall project costs. When labor costs rise, builders are compelled to increase the prices of their services, contributing to the overall escalation of housing prices. This scenario creates a double-edged sword: while higher wages are essential to ensure fair Compensation for workers, they simultaneously contribute to making homes less affordable for potential buyers.

Land and Regulatory Costs

Inflation’s impact on home building doesn’t stop at materials and labor. Land prices and regulatory costs are additional components that significantly contribute to the overall cost of constructing new homes. As demand for housing continues to grow, the cost of available land has also risen. This is particularly evident in urban areas where space is limited and competition for land is fierce.

Moreover, regulatory costs, including permits, inspections, and compliance with building codes, have also seen an upward trajectory. While these regulations are essential for ensuring the safety and quality of homes, the increased costs associated with them pose a challenge for builders who are already grappling with other inflation-induced expenses.

Implications for Homebuyers and the Housing Market**

The cumulative effects of inflation on home building have significant implications for homebuyers and the housing market as a whole. As the cost of construction materials, labor, land, and regulations continue to rise, the prices of newly constructed homes are also climbing. This trend has the potential to make homeownership less attainable for many individuals and families, especially those with lower incomes or first-time homebuyers.

Furthermore, the affordability crisis in the housing market can impact the overall health of the real estate industry. A slowdown in new home construction due to higher costs could lead to a shortage of available housing units, which may result in increased competition for existing homes and drive up their prices as well.

Conclusion

Inflation’s impact on home building in the USA is undeniable, with rising costs of materials, labor shortages, and escalating land and regulatory expenses all contributing to the challenges faced by the construction industry. As builders grapple with these inflation-induced pressures, potential homebuyers find themselves facing higher prices for new homes, making the dream of homeownership seem further out of reach.

Addressing these challenges requires a multi-faceted approach, involving collaboration between government entities, builders, and other stakeholders. Policymakers need to consider ways to streamline regulations without compromising safety standards, and the construction industry must explore innovative methods to enhance efficiency and productivity.

Introduction to Model Engines

Model engines are precise, scaled-down replicas of real engines that power various model vehicles and devices. These engines are far from mere toys; they are sophisticated simulations that emulate the real-life operations of actual engines. They may operate on electricity, gasoline, or steam and are popular in several hobbies, including model aviation and radio-controlled vehicles.

Diverse Types of Model Engines

Understanding the different types of model engines can enhance your hobby experience, allowing for better choices and more suitable applications. Here’s an overview of the most common types:

1. Electric Motors

  • Uses: Predominantly found in RC cars, boats, and aircraft.
  • Benefits: Electric motors are silent, economical, and simple to maintain.
  • Power Source: Generally powered by rechargeable batteries.

2. Internal Combustion Engines

  • Uses: Ideal for powering more robust model airplanes, helicopters, and cars.
  • Sub-types:
    • Glow Plug Engines: Small engines utilizing a glow plug for ignition.
    • Gasoline Engines: More powerful, these engines run on a mix of gasoline and oil.
  • Benefits: Renowned for their robust power and the authentic operational experience they offer.

3. Steam Engines

  • Uses: Commonly used in model boats and stationary models that replicate historical machinery.
  • Benefits: Steam engines are appreciated for their historical allure and mechanical complexity.
  • Power Source: Powered by burning materials like coal, wood, or oil.

4. Jet Engines

  • Uses: Employed in advanced model airplanes and jets.
  • Benefits: Offers substantial power and speed, delivering an exhilarating flying experience.
  • Sub-types:
    • Turbojet Engines: Produces thrust through high-speed jet emissions.
    • Turboprop Engines: Combines jet thrust and propeller action for improved efficiency at lower velocities.

Operational Mechanics of Model Engines

Grasping how model engines function is essential for hobbyists. These engines convert various types of energy into mechanical energy, powering the motion of model vehicles. Electric models use batteries to deliver power to motors which translate electrical energy into movement. Similarly, internal combustion and jet engines mimic their larger counterparts by burning fuel to generate power.

Selecting the Right Model Engine

The choice of model engine depends on the model type, desired performance, and personal preferences regarding upkeep and noise levels. Here are some aspects to keep in mind:

  • Model Compatibility: Different models perform optimally with specific engine types. For instance, Electric engines are suitable for beginners and indoor models, whereas fuel-based engines are better for outdoor and larger models.
  • Performance Requirements: Engines with higher power often provide superior performance but may need more frequent maintenance.
  • Maintenance Preference: Electric engines require less upkeep than gas engines, which need regular maintenance and fuel management.

Maintenance Strategies for Model Engines

To ensure your model engine operates flawlessly and endures, proper maintenance is crucial. Consider these tips:

  • Routine Cleaning: Regularly clean your engine to remove any accumulated dirt, oil, and debris.
  • Lubrication: Keep all moving parts well-lubricated to minimize friction and wear.
  • Fuel and Battery Checks: Always use fresh fuel and ensure that batteries are fully charged for best performance.

Benefits of the Modified Lothrop ProcedureBenefits of the Modified Lothrop Procedure

A Quick Anatomy Review of the Frontal Sinus

The modified Lothrop procedure is used to treat the affected frontal sinus surgically. The frontal sinus is an asymmetrical pair of moist air pockets above the eyebrows. It is separated by a bony partition called the inter-sinus septum. Each frontal sinus drains out through its opening, the frontonasal duct, which leads into the nasal cavity. 

All sinuses drain into the nasal cavity, which has soft tissue and bony structures that create pathways for airflow. For example, the nasal septum separates the nasal cavity vertically, making breathing on each nostril unilateral. 

When the frontal sinus is affected, the doctor may remove parts of these structures to widen the frontonasal ducts and improve drainage. One such procedure is the modified Lothrop. 

Understanding the Modified Lothrop Procedure

The initial Lothrop procedure is an open surgery in which the inter-sinus septum is removed. The Surgeon also cuts out parts of the nasal septum and the bony partition between the nasofrontal ducts.

The modified Lothrop Procedure is completely internasal and shares the same goals. It’s a more minimally invasive procedure that creates an enlarged frontonasal cavity by removing the frontal sinus floor, inter-sinus septum, upper nasal septum, and the frontal beak of the inner skull.

This procedure uses an endoscope, a thin wire with a tiny light and camera on one end, to guide the doctor in resecting bones and tissues. The endoscope is inserted inside the nose with tiny surgical tools such as a soft-tissue shaver and bone-cutting drill.

Advantages of the Modified Lothrop Procedure

The modified Lothrop procedure shares the benefits of all endoscopic sinus surgical techniques.

Commonly, an Outpatient Procedure

The modified Lothrop procedure is commonly performed as an outpatient procedure. Depending on the state of the frontal sinus, the operation can take 1-3 hours to complete.

After surgery, the patients are placed in a recovery room for a few hours until they are well enough to go home.

No Scarring

Because it is endoscopic, modified Lothrop does not result in any facial scarring or changes to the shape of your nose.

A Modified Lothrop procedure involves inserting an endoscope and Small surgical tools through your nose. Because the endoscope’s light and camera guide the doctor, they can improve the frontal sinus opening without open surgery.

However, some scar tissue may develop inside the nose. This concern is solved with post-operative follow-up visits for necessary scar tissue removal under local anesthesia.

Excellent Frontal Sinus Visualization Post-Operation

In a 2018 retrospective review, 84% of patients who underwent the modified Lothrop procedure sustained expansion of the widened frontonasal ducts. The expansion was graded endoscopically after each post-operative visit. Those who suffer from partial or closed openings post-operation are caused by scarring effects of persistent inflammation from their conditions, such as chronic rhinitis and nasal polyps.

High Cure Rate for Chronic Frontal Sinusitis

In the same review, 78% of patients require no further revision surgery after undergoing a modified Lothrop procedure. 90% of the patients reported “significant clinical improvement” at the latest recorded follow-up.

Those who are more likely to require revision surgery are those with the presence of inflamed tissue, often from reoccurring conditions, with the majority of the patients suffering from chronic rhinitis.

Surgical Indications: Who Can Benefit from the Modified Lothrop Procedure

The modified Lothrop procedure can reduce the number of surgeries for people with severe chronic sinusitis. According to the same review, those with oral mucus cysts and tumors can also benefit from this resection procedure. By removing the affected parts and widening the frontonasal ducts, patients can experience improved quality of life.
